Fortnite Reveals New Look at Chapter 6 Season 2 Gameplay and Skins

A new trailer for Chapter 6 Season 2 of Fortnite teases plenty of new twists and updates to the Battle Royale gameplay loop, along with a better look at the new Battle Pass skins in action. Fortnite upcoming season is called Lawless, featuring a changed world where its characters appear to have turned to a life of crime, contrasting last season’s focus on demon hunting.fortnite-lawless-screenshot-6

Although this won’t be the first heist-related season that Fortnite has introduced to its players, this one could offer even more in-depth mechanics and minigames related to the idea. It does seem like the previous heist season’s focus on loot-filled duffel bags may return, bringing back some of the best ideas from the past. Heists appear to be a theme Fortnite’s developers enjoy coming back to and a concept that fans routinely get hyped about.

A new Fortnite trailer dropped on the game’s social media accounts, offering players a first look at gameplay for Chapter 6 Season 2, and there are plenty of aspects that have received a shakeup. The new trailer shows off new skin Big Dill alongside The Brat, a more classic skin, rapping over a beat as the various new Battle Pass characters engage in mayhem throughout the map. These characters appear to be making the most of the action happening in an array of new POIs, perhaps most notably using dynamite charges to bust open a bank vault.

As these new characters battle throughout the upgraded map, players can be seen grinding down rails into tunnels. Rail Grinding has been present in Fortnite for a while now, but it seems like there may be more opportunities to make use of the feature in a map that could prioritize heist-related hijinks and quick getaways. Glimpses of buildings redesigned to follow the season’s theme reveal a grittier aesthetic drenched in shadows that clash with bright neon lights, along with overcast skies. Players are shown wall jumping and building to pull off skilled kills and evade some of the newer weapons in play.

Many new gadgets are teased, with characters using various Shotguns, one new Double-Barrel type, and a Pump Shotgun that appears to be enhanced by an upgrade bench. A laser beam is used to slice an opening into a vault, but it’s also shown in battle. It may have strong damage potential, but it seems to be slower than other weapons. The previously leaked Rocket Drill is also teased, hinting that this season may feature plenty of old and new ideas coming together to make something fresh. Season 6 Chapter 2 is set to drop on Friday, February 21.
